The gradient and the Hessian of the distance between point and triangle in 3D (Q2287494)

From MaRDI portal





scientific article; zbMATH DE number 7154088
Language Label Description Also known as
default for all languages
No label defined
    English
    The gradient and the Hessian of the distance between point and triangle in 3D
    scientific article; zbMATH DE number 7154088

      Statements

      The gradient and the Hessian of the distance between point and triangle in 3D (English)
      0 references
      0 references
      0 references
      0 references
      0 references
      21 January 2020
      0 references
      Summary: Computation of the distance between point and triangle in 3D is a common task in numerical analysis. The input values of the algorithm are coordinates of three points of the triangle and one point from which the distance is determined. An existing algorithm is extended to compute the gradient and the Hessian of that distance with respect to coordinates of involved points. Derivation of exact expressions for gradient and Hessian is presented, and numerical accuracy is evaluated for various cases. The algorithm has \(O(1)\) time and space complexity. The included open-source code may be used in applications where derivatives of point-triangle distance are required.
      0 references
      point-triangle distance
      0 references
      gradient
      0 references
      Hessian
      0 references
      0 references

      Identifiers